Live-Forum - Die aktuellen Beiträge
Anzeige
Archiv - Navigation
796to800
Aktuelles Verzeichnis
Verzeichnis Index
Übersicht Verzeichnisse
Vorheriger Thread
Rückwärts Blättern
Nächster Thread
Vorwärts blättern
Anzeige
HERBERS
Excel-Forum (Archiv)
20+ Jahre Excel-Kompetenz: Von Anwendern, für Anwender
796to800
796to800
Aktuelles Verzeichnis
Verzeichnis Index
Verzeichnis Index
Übersicht Verzeichnisse
Inhaltsverzeichnis

2 Worksheet_Change-Bedingungen vereinen

2 Worksheet_Change-Bedingungen vereinen
01.09.2006 20:39:43
Korl
Hallo,
wie kann ich 2 Worksheet_Change-Bedingungen vereinen?
Private Sub Worksheet_Change(ByVal Target As Range)
If Target.Address = "$B$2" Then
On Error Resume Next
Me.Shapes("curPic").Delete
Sheets("Tabelle3").Shapes(Target.Text).Copy
Me.Paste
With Me.Shapes(Me.Shapes.Count)
.Name = "curPic"
.Left = 100
.Top = 250
End With
Target.Select
End If
End Sub
Private Sub Worksheet_Change(ByVal Target As Range)
'Überwachung eines Bereiches "B17:B37"
Dim z As Range, rng As Range
If Target(1).Value <> "" Then Exit Sub ' Abbruch, wenn Wert eingetragen wurde
Set rng = Intersect(Target, Range("B17:B37"))
If Not rng Is Nothing Then
    For Each z In rng
        Range(z.Offset(0, 1), z.Offset(0, 2)).ClearContents
    Next z
End If
End Sub
Ist das so ohne weiteres möglich?
Gruß Korl

2
Beiträge zum Forumthread
Beiträge zu diesem Forumthread

Betreff
Datum
Anwender
Anzeige
AW: 2 Worksheet_Change-Bedingungen vereinen
01.09.2006 20:45:47
Jens

Private Sub Worksheet_Change(ByVal Target As Range)
If Target.Address = "$B$2" Then
On Error Resume Next
Me.Shapes("curPic").Delete
Sheets("Tabelle3").Shapes(Target.Text).Copy
Me.Paste
With Me.Shapes(Me.Shapes.Count)
.Name = "curPic"
.Left = 100
.Top = 250
End With
Target.Select
End If
'Überwachung eines Bereiches "B17:B37"
Dim z As Range, rng As Range
If Target(1).Value <> "" Then Exit Sub ' Abbruch, wenn Wert eingetragen wurde
Set rng = Intersect(Target, Range("B17:B37"))
If Not rng Is Nothing Then
For Each z In rng
Range(z.Offset(0, 1), z.Offset(0, 2)).ClearContents
Next z
End If
End Sub

Code eingefügt mit strg + V
mfg Jens
Anzeige
AW: 2 Worksheet_Change-Bedingungen vereinen
01.09.2006 21:32:22
Korl
Hallo Jens,
ich danke Dir, es haut hin.
Eigentlich hatte ich diese Varinate auch schon probiert, aber umgekehrt. ;-)
Nochmals Danke.
Gruß Korl

Beliebteste Forumthreads (12 Monate)

Anzeige

Beliebteste Forumthreads (12 Monate)

Anzeige
Anzeige
Anzeige